Texas Instruments OPA2234U/2K5 technical specifications, attributes, parameters and parts with similar specifications to Texas Instruments OPA2234U/2K5.
- Lifecycle StatusLIFEBUY (Last Updated: 3 days ago)
- Contact PlatingGold
- Mounting TypeSurface Mount
- Package / Case8-SOIC (0.154, 3.90mm Width)
- Surface MountYES
- Number of Pins8
- Operating Temperature-40°C~85°C
- PackagingTape & Reel (TR)
- JESD-609 Codee4
- Pbfree Codeyes
- Part StatusLast Time Buy
- Moisture Sensitivity Level (MSL)3 (168 Hours)
- Number of Terminations8
- ECCN CodeEAR99
- SubcategoryOperational Amplifier
- Packing MethodTR
- TechnologyBIPOLAR
- Terminal PositionDUAL
- Terminal FormGULL WING
- Peak Reflow Temperature (Cel)260
- Number of Functions2
- Supply Voltage15V
- Base Part NumberOPA2234
- Pin Count8
- Operating Supply Voltage18V
- Number of Elements2
- Operating Supply Current275μA
- Nominal Supply Current700μA
- Slew Rate0.2V/μs
- ArchitectureVOLTAGE-FEEDBACK
- Amplifier TypeGeneral Purpose
- Common Mode Rejection Ratio91 dB
- Current - Input Bias12nA
- Voltage - Supply, Single/Dual (±)2.7V~36V ±1.35V~18V
- Output Current per Channel22mA
- Input Offset Voltage (Vos)100μV
- Bandwidth350 kHz
- Neg Supply Voltage-Nom (Vsup)-15V
- Unity Gain BW-Nom350 kHz
- Voltage Gain120dB
- Power Supply Rejection Ratio (PSRR)110.46dB
- Low-OffsetYES
- Frequency CompensationYES
- Voltage - Input Offset70μV
- Low-BiasNO
- MicropowerYES
- Programmable PowerNO
- Nominal Gain Bandwidth Product350 kHz
- Max I/O Voltage100μV
- Input Offset Current-Max (IIO)0.005μA
- Height1.75mm
- Length4.9mm
- Width3.91mm
- Thickness1.58mm
- Radiation HardeningNo
- RoHS StatusROHS3 Compliant
- Lead FreeLead Free
